The way Pachuca plays has been a topic of discussion this season. The team is characterized by an offensive approach that involves the active participation of midfielders and forwards. Often, you can see coordinated movements that wear down the opposing defense. It is a possession game where each pass counts.

One thing that stands out in Pachuca's play is their ability to adapt to different opponents. In recent matches, they have shown impressive tactical flexibility, adjusting to the pressure exerted by teams like Cruz Azul. This adaptability has allowed them to stay competitive in the league standings.

wing play is essential to their strategy. Players like C. Alfaro have been crucial in stretching the field, creating space for the attackers to penetrate. This keeps the opponent on constant alert, as any oversight can result in a goal against.
